* Refining feedstock is conventional oil. The Suncor and Shell refineries are configured to handle feedstock from oil sands.
** The Husky Asphalt Refinery in Lloydminster, Alberta is integrated with the Husky Upgrader in Lloydminster, Saskatchewan which produces synthetic crude oil from heavy oil in the two provinces. The refinery produces asphalt products, which are then transported to market.
